Code Section 30.02 shall be amended by adding sections (E) and (F) as follows: (E) Duties of Mayor. The mayor sball preside at meetings of the council and sball have a vote as a member, except that the council shall choose from its members a mayor pro tern who shall hold office at the pleasure of the council and sball serve as mayor in case of the mayor's disability or absence. The mayor shall exercise aU powers and perform aU duties conferred and imposed upon the mayor by ordinances of the city and the laws of the state. The mayor sball be recognized as the head of city government for aU ceremonial purposes, by the courts for serving civil process, and by the governor for purposes of marital law, but shall have no administrative duties unless specifica1ly ordained. The mayor may deliver messages to the council and the public, including a comprehensive message on the 9Jlnua1 state of the city. (FJ Duties of the Council The council, including the mayor sitting as presiding officer of the council shall, shall exercise all powers and perform. aU duties conferred and imposed upon its members by ordinances of the city and the laws of the state. Consistent with the responsibilities to accept considerable leadership over the general conduct of city affairs, the members sball study the operations of the city goveiiu:nent, and recommend desirable changes and improvements to the council. To that end the members must perform. all of the duties of office including but not limited to attendance at all regular and special meetings to the council, and aU atteNIant and supporting duties such as service on, or liaison to committees of city government or city services, serving as public representatives of the city, and by generally educating themselves about the affairs of government by listening and responding to members of the community. Section 2. Eff'edive Date. This ordinance shall be effective immediately upon its passage and publication according to law.
